A costly and complex clean-up is resuscitating the River ... WebINHALATION: R-134a is low in acute toxicity in animals. When oxygen levels in air are reduced to 12-14% by displacement, symptoms of asphyxiation, loss of coordination, increased pulse rate and deeper respiration will occur. At high levels, cardiac arrhythmia may occur. INGESTION: Ingestion is unlikely because of the low boiling point of the ...
